
The Christian Life Pt. 1 | A Future of Hope | 1 Peter 1:17-21
Pastor Jack explains the high call for godly living in light of the price that was paid for our redemption. The precious blood of Jesus did not save us so that we could then live as if we were hopeless. Peter reminded readers that those who believe in God are not disappointed because their faith and hope has been substantiated by Jesus’ resurrection from the dead.
